Café <a href="https://nycrestaurantvoice.com/harlem-spot-seeks-to-reinvent-neighborhood-dining-20260418071519/">Harlem</a> has introduced a new menu emphasizing ingredients sourced from local farms and producers. The changes include new entrees and desserts showcasing seasonal New York State products.

Chef-owner Lisa Monroe said the update reflects a commitment to support regional agriculture and reduce the <a href="https://nycrestaurantvoice.com/801-restaurant-group-files-for-chapter-11-amid-financial-restructuring-20260418014016/">restaurant</a>'s environmental footprint.

Café Harlem has operated in the neighborhood since 2015, serving a mix of American and Caribbean-<a href="https://nycrestaurantvoice.com/spring-inspired-dinner-ideas-from-a-recent-new-york-times-feature-20260417105554/">inspired</a> dishes.
